2026 ICD-10-CM Diagnosis Code I50.8 – Other heart failure
What it is
I50.8 is used for heart failure that does not fit the more specific ICD-10 categories. It indicates impaired cardiac pumping or filling, but the documentation does not identify a better-defined type.
Clinical signs
Clinical features vary; refer to documentation. Common findings in heart failure include dyspnea, fatigue, edema, and signs of fluid overload, but you should code only what the provider documents.
When to use this code
Use I50.8 when the record states “other heart failure” or describes heart failure without enough detail for a more specific code. It may apply when the provider documents a nonstandard subtype or mixed features that do not map cleanly to another I50 code. Check documentation if the note is vague or incomplete.
Do not use for
Do not use this code when the documentation clearly identifies systolic, diastolic, combined, or unspecified heart failure. If the provider names a specific heart failure type, code that diagnosis instead.
Coding tip
Query the provider when the chart says only “heart failure” and the type is unclear.
